Basic circuit |
When using one wire, one battery, and one bulb you can make the light bulb light up. Remember that there are two points on a light bulb that must have connections to a battery and wire to work. | |

Parallel and Series Circuits |
In a parallel circuit, if you remove one light bulb the rest will work.
In a series circuit, if you remove one light bulb ALL of the lights will go OUT. | | |

Circuit Tester |
A circuit tester is used to see if a material is a conductor or an insulator.
A conductor is any material that allows electricity to flow through it.
An insulator is any material that does NOT allow electricity to flow through it. | |

Electromagnet |
You can create an electromagnet by using one iron nail, one long wire, and a battery.
Using an electromagnet, you can test to see if a material is magnetic. | |
